Plateau is on Interstate Highway 10 at exit 159, and the Missouri Pacific rail line sixteen miles east of Van Horn in south central Culberson County. The town, named for its location on a flat plain, was the site of a section house on the Texas and Pacific Railway, which built through the area in the early 1880s. The Balmorhea State ParkLocated 75 east of Van Horn on IH-10. The park's main attraction is a large (77,053 sq. ft.) artesian spring pool that is fed by San Solomon Springs. The springs also fill a 'cienega' (desert wetland) and the canals of a refugium, a home to endangered fish species, assorted invertebrates, and turtles. The pool differs from most public pools in several respects: the 1 3/4-acre size, the 25-foot depth and the 72 to 76 degree constant temperature. It also has a variety of aquatic life in its clear waters. The Balmorhea lake is stocked with crappie, bass, catfish, and perch. The area in and around this Lake is also renowned for its bird life. Visitors can enjoy swimming, scuba diving, picnicking, camping, an outdoor sports area; and picnic sites.

Guadalupe Mountains National Park Home of the famous El Capitan. While scenic driving in the park is limited to one 4X4 road, there are over 80 miles of trails that offer a wide range of opportunities for exploring. Other available activities include: backpacking, camping and wildlife viewing, photography, and horseback riding. Visitors may also see ruins of a stage station, or visit the Frijole Ranch History Museum. Excavators have found spearheads, pictographs and human remains together with bones of long-extinct bison, dire wolf and musk ox in cliff caves. At hermit cave in last chance canyon, carbon-14 dating indicates occupancy 12,000 years ago. Geologically, the Guadalupes present a spectacular exposure of the famous capitan prehistoric barrier reef, said to be the most extensive fossil organic reef known.
